

Our family shares the news that our Lord’s faithful servant, Patricia (Tish) Eilene Conejo passed away peacefully on Thursday, July 17, 2025 in Olathe, Kansas surrounded by family after complications from a long courageous battle with Amyotrophic Lateral Sclerosis (ALS). Tish’s life was marked by love and laughter with an unwavering devotion to her husband; and an unconditional love of her family and friends forming lifelong friendships as a cornerstone of her life.
Tish was born on April 4, 1955 in Kansas City, Missouri as a beloved daughter of Pat and David Eddings. Tish was a graduate of Washington High School in Kansas City, Kansas. Doctor Conejo, PhD of Philosophy – Nursing; RN and Certified Women’s Health Nurse Practitioner (WHNP) was a PhD graduate from the University of Kansas in 2010. She was passionate to educating ‘tomorrow’s’ nurses for lifelong learning and impact in the workforce as a university professor for 31 years to help nurses succeed and, in reaching their goals beginning at Park (College) University; the University of Texas/El Paso; Virginia Commonwealth University/Richmond; Germanna Community College/Virginia; Avila University; then rounded out her teaching career at MidAmerica University where she achieved the position of Department Chair, Traditional BSN Studies. Her education began with an Associate’s Degree at Kansas City Kansas Community Junior College; continued with a Bachelor of Science in Nursing then a Master of Science Degree in Nursing at the University of Kansas; and, then followed by her Doctorate of Philosophy/Nursing from the University of Kansas. She was licensed in the states of Kansas; Missouri; Texas; and, Virginia. During June 2013, Tish was instrumental in creating the Simulation Lab at MidAmerica Nazarene University: School of Nursing. She published several articles in medical journals.
